About Atal Pension Yojana

Atal Pension Yojana is a pension scheme launched by the Prime Minister of India Shri Narendra Modi in 2015. This pension scheme is mainly targeted at people whose monthly income is very low such as maids, drivers, gardeners, delivery boys, and farmers. Earlier the name of this pension was “Swabalamban Yojana” but due to the failure of the previous scheme with this name it has been replaced as “Atal Pension Yojana”. The common people of India have benefited a lot from this scheme.

Eligibility Criteria

  • Must Be citizen In India
  • Must Be Between The Age 18-40
  • Should Have Ability To Contribute for Minimum 20Years
  • Must-Have A bank Account Linked to Aadhar Card
  • Applicants Must Have Aadhar Card/Voter ID/Ration Card
  • Must Have a Valid Phone No

Benefits

All investors will get a pension of Rs 1000, Rs 2000, Rs 3000, Rs 4000, and Rs 5000 per month after their 60Year age based on their investment by investing very little money every month.

Required Documents

  •  Proof of identity( Xerox of Adhar/Ration /Voter Card )
  • Proof of address,
  • Photo(color)
  • Document having date of birth
  • Bank Passbook First Page Xerox Copy

How To Apply

All Nationalized Bank Provide This Scheme. You can visit any of these Banks to Start your APY account.
